SC9632 Overview
SC9632 is a differential Hall Effect sensor IC with two independent channels providing quadrature outputs. The device provides a high sensitivity and a superior stability over temperature and symmetrical thresholds in order to achieve a stable duty cycle. The integrated circuit is response to changing differential magnetic fields created by rotating ring magnets and by ferrous targets when coupled with a magnet.
SC9632 Key Features
- Two independent digital quadrature A/B outputs
- Large air gap
- South and North pole pre-induction
- Low start-up voltage: 3.8V (Typ.)
- Reduced power consumption: 6.5mA
- Accurate true zero-crossing switch-point
- 40℃-150℃ operating temperature
- Over-voltage protection in all PIN
- Reverse-current protection in VDD PIN
